Output 31e7fc39c470e195440f09e38087828ae8a5cbc6da54833d9b89a951213b94d9:18

value
85255
script pubkey
OP_0 OP_PUSHBYTES_20 13627c03f6457586a5691b4688f27c7a0d4ff288
address
bc1qzd38cqlkg46cdftfrdrg3unu0gx5lu5gen3hdp
transaction
31e7fc39c470e195440f09e38087828ae8a5cbc6da54833d9b89a951213b94d9
confirmations
70051
spent
true